what vitamin d boost drip is
the vitamin d boost drip delivers vitamin d in a form that enters circulation directly, helping address a deficiency that is surprisingly common even in sunny climates because of indoor lifestyles, sun protection and modest covering. vitamin d plays a role in bone health, immune function and mood, and many people in the uae run lower than they expect.

why would i be low on vitamin d in a sunny country?
indoor work, air conditioning, sun protection and covering can all limit how much vitamin d the skin produces. deficiency is common in the region despite the climate. a blood test confirms your level.
